Pasadena PD Release Sketch of Suspect in Murder Investigation

by Pasadena Independent
share with
Sketch of one suspect. – Courtesy photo / Pasadena PD

On Saturday, May 23, 2020 at approximately 4:10 p.m., Pasadena police responded to the 1500 block of North Lake Avenue regarding a shooting that resulted in the murder of Ray Magee Jr. and the attempted murder of a 23-year-old male.

Pasadena homicide detectives released a photo from surveillance video of the actual suspect vehicle on July 24, 2020. The vehicle was described as a 2017 Dodge Charger with tinted windows and the last two numbers of the license plate are “50.” The suspects responsible for the murder and attempted murder of the victims were last seen fleeing southbound on Lake Avenue.

Actual suspect vehicle (2017 Dodge Charger) from surveillance video. – Courtesy photo / Pasadena PD

Homicidedetectives are now releasing a composite sketch of one suspect.

Oneof the murder suspects has been described as a Black male who is approximately25 to 30 years old. He was further described as having a light complexion,weighing 170 to 180 pounds and approximately 5-foot-6 to 5-foot-8.

Detectives are asking persons who may have information regarding this murder and attempted murder, or the composite sketch, to call the Pasadena police at (626) 744-4241.
